drill down
Third Person
drills down
Present Participle
drilling down
Past Tense
drilled down
Past Participle
drilled down
1
to investigate or analyze something in detail
- The manager asked the team to drill down into the sales data to identify specific trends and patterns.
- They spent hours drilling down into the financial statements to find the discrepancy.
- He drilled down into the customer feedback to find recurring complaints.
- During the financial audit, the accountant had to drill down into each expense category for a comprehensive analysis.
- If you drill down, you’ll see that the issue lies in the supply chain.
